Heading Style Field allows you to define a flexible heading field that can be any configured heading style, no style or even no heading. Each field instance can be configured to have different styles available.
The main use case for this field type is with the Paragraphs module. You can add this field to each paragraph where there might need to be a heading and allow the content editor to decide on the heading level. If you identify any other use cases please feed back.
Default help text is provided to help users understand the purpose and benefits of structured help text and this will be the default across all field instances unless you have modified it consistently in more than one instance.
In addition to the default format that provides semantic HTML structure, a Preview format is provided that gives in plain text the heading with the style in brackets or "No heading" that can be used for the "Paragraphs Editor Preview".
The default format includes an HTML ID and meaningful classes to help you target a given heading.
